I was recently prompted to update my Itunes player to the latest version. I'm using Windows Vista. I was left with an error message MSVCR80.dll and consequently no new update. I uninstalled the old version and have tried to reinstall manually several times. No luck. Consequently I have no player.
Any ideas for a fix?Go to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s (Win XP) or Programs and Features (later)
Remove all of these items in the following order:
iTunes
Apple Software Update
Apple Mobile Device Support (if this won't uninstall move on to the next item)
Bonjour
Apple Application Support
Reboot, download iTunes, then reinstall, either using an account with administrative rights, or right-clicking the downloaded installer and selecting Run as Administrator.
The uninstall and reinstall process will preserve your iTunes library and settings, but ideally you would back up the library and your other important personal documents and data on a regular basis. See this user tip for a suggested technique.
Please note:
Some users may need to follow all the steps in whichever of the following support documents applies to their system. These include some additional manual file and folder deletions not mentioned above.
HT1925: Removing and Reinstalling iTunes for Windows XP
HT1923: Removing and reinstalling iTunes for Windows Vista, Windows 7, or Windows 8

Wanted to save space on C: drive and installed Firefox 4.0 on the F: drive. The new install did not delete the files of the older Firefox version in the C: drive. Is the 4.0 version in F: drive using any of the files left on the C: drive? Can I delete or uninstall the old version with out losing bookmarks or other vital information? I want to get the space back for the C: drive but don't want a big headache. When comparing file trees from the new install and the old, there were allot more files in the old and it made me afraid to delete or uninstall the old version.
The version on the C drive can be deleted, it will not be used. The bookmarks, along with other user data, is stored in the profile folder which is in a different location than the application - http://kb.mozillazine.org/Profile_folder_-_Firefox
There are more files in the old version, many of the files in the new version are placed inside omni.jar which is a compressed file. -

After installing PS and LR newer CC versions, should uninstall the previous versions? Computer is running ver slow in those programs.
you can uninstall them, but do not need to uninstall them. you should probably wait a few months to make sure all your peripherals and plugins work with the cc 2014 versions before uninstalling cc.
